Stuffed Crust Pizza and the low FODMAP diet
A cheese-filled dough edge combined with standard toppings creates a heavy meal where flour density and dairy concentration drive digestive outcomes. The wheat crust introduces significant fructans, while commercial cheese blends frequently contain high-fructose stabilizers and fresh milk powder that elevate lactose sensitivity symptoms. Careful substitution ensures much safer consumption. Strategic modification prevents cumulative gastrointestinal distress.

What can change the result?
Request the crust completely plain without any cheese-stuffed edges to eliminate the concentrated wheat and lactose exposure during the meal. Replace the standard dough with a certified gluten-free flatbread base to completely remove the primary fructan trigger. Verify that all cheese layers consist of aged varieties instead of soft commercial blends that elevate dairy sensitivity symptoms for sensitive diners. Does portion size matter?
Yes. FODMAP load depends on quantity and can also be affected by other foods eaten in the same meal.
Can everyone with IBS tolerate it?
No food result predicts individual tolerance. A dietitian can help interpret symptoms, portions, and reintroduction challenges.
